Oven Disposal Service Questions
What types of ovens can be disposed of? The service handles various oven types, including built-in, freestanding, electric, and gas models.
Is appliance removal included with oven disposal? Yes, removal of the old oven is part of the disposal process, ensuring it is safely taken away from the property.
Are there any items that cannot be disposed of? Items containing hazardous materials or non-standard components may require special handling and are not included in standard disposal services.
What should property owners do before disposal? Clear the area around the oven and disconnect it from power or gas sources prior to service.
